Runbook: LiftSim Dispatch Replay

To replay a dispatch scenario, load the building profile, set car count and traffic curve, then run the batch scheduler. Divergence above 3% between simulated and recorded wait times triggers an automatic flag for review. Replay results and scenario seeds are stored in the simulation database, which you can reach with the connection string below.

replica DSN, yahog-kawig: redis://istox_svc:um@db-8a67.halixforge.test:5432/frawyn

// REINDEX_BATCH_CAP limits docs per shard pass in the Tallowfield
// nightly search reindex. Raising it starves the ingest queue;
// lowering it overruns the maintenance window. 5000 is the tested
// sweet spot. Change only with a soak run. Verified against the
// build noted below.

session token of bawif-hahog = htk6_ac5981

Heads up for on-call: the Crumbline order-cutoff rule moved from 2pm to noon for next-day bakery orders, but a few cached storefronts still show the old time. If a customer order slips past cutoff, the reconciler quietly bumps it a day — that's the source of most 'missing order' pages. The override procedure is documented on the internal page below.

dashboard of tawef-hagug = https://superset.norvadyn.local/display/projects/build/ticket/build/spaces/ticket/1e989f0e6c200d20fc4ae06b

Handover: GPU memory profiling (Gritmarch tooling)

Taking over from me is straightforward. The Gritmarch profiler samples allocator events on the Duskpane render nodes and ships traces to the Ovenlight dashboard. Sampling overhead sits around 2%. Known quirk: fragmentation stats reset on driver reload, so annotate restarts. Cron rebuilds the symbol cache weekly. The profiler daemon starts with the following configuration:

config for yajep-tafof:
[rusath]
team = julmir
access_code = ac_fe37fd
host = rusath.novactech.test
port = 8000
owner = pelmir.weneth
peer = oliwyn.olvarqdyn.internal